Can I add someone to my Canvas course?

You can manually add other guests, such as faculty, TAs, librarians, industry experts or observers, to your Canvas course when they have a UW NetID or a Google account ID. From within your Canvas course, in the course navigation, click People. Near the top of the page, click +People.

How do I share courses content using canvas?

Sending Content to Another Instructor

  • To send a page, assignment, quiz or discussion, go to the item and select the Option icon (3 vertical dots) and then Send to.
  • Faculty can search for other faculty via email address. ...
  • Select the name of the user when it appears.
  • The same content may be sent to more than one user by adding other users individually.

Can I make my own course on Canvas?

If you are allowed to add new courses in Canvas, you can create a new course from your Canvas Dashboard. New courses are created as course shells which can host course content and enrollments for your institution. If enabled by your institution, you may be able to select a sub-account for your new course.

How do I create a course section in Canvas?

How do I add a section to a course as an instructor?Open Settings. In Course Navigation, click the Settings link.Open Sections. Click the Sections tab.Add Section. In the section field [1], type the name of the new section. Click the Add Section button [2].View Section. View the section in your course.

What is a sandbox course in Canvas?

A sandbox course is a private space where you can test items without impacting your live course(s). In your Sandbox Course, you will have the instructor role that allows you to utilize and practice with all tools available in a regular Canvas course.

What is a course section in Canvas?

Sections help subdivide students within a course. Sections are either courses that have been cross-listed into one course or sections can be created by you and students added to them. There is a whole section in the Guides titled Courses and Sections.

What is the difference between sections and groups in Canvas?

Sections in Canvas are used to segment the people in a class, typically based on their teaching fellows or meeting times. Groups, on the other hand, are used as a collaborative tool for students to work on group projects and assignments.

What is a new course?

New courses are created as course shells that can host course content and enrollments for your institution. When you create a course from the Dashboard, you are automatically added to the course as an instructor. No other enrollments exist in the course, though you may be able to add users to a new course.

How many characters are in a course name?

If your course name is longer than 21 characters, you can create a course code in the Short Name field [2]. If your course name is too short to create a Short Name, a short name will automatically be created for you.

Where is the short name on Courses?

The short name will be displayed at the top of the Course Navigation menu and in the course card in the dashboard. If you have permission to edit the course name, you may be able to change the course name and code later in Course Settings.
